The college has launched a new campaign to recruit governors to the board.
The college has campuses across King’s Lynn, Wisbech and Cambridge, teaching a variety of different subjects from foundation to degree level, apprenticeships and commercial training to over 7,000 students.
The college is looking for individuals with backgrounds in education, business, finance, auditing and HR who can use their skills to provide strategic leadership for the college as well as oversee its educational and financial performance.
Governors are asked to attend up to 12 meetings per year, usually held on a Wednesday morning. Governors are also invited to attend college presentations and other events.
As a governor, you will bring valuable experience to the board to support and challenge senior leaders. Being a governor is an opportunity for you to ‘give back’ to the local community, enhance your own professional skills and to make a positive contribution to the college and the local area.
The college has recently a ‘good’ rating by Ofsted, judging it to be good across all eight areas of inspection: effectiveness of leadership and management; quality of teaching, learning and assessment; personal development, behaviour and welfare; outcomes for learners; 16 to 19 study programmes; adult learning programmes; apprenticeships; and provision for learners with high needs.
